AulaPratica07Decodificadores

6
CENTRO UNIVERSITÁRIO UNA INSTITUTO POLITÉCNICO Laboratório de Sistemas Digitais Professores: Breno Arêdes e Hugo Michel AULA PRÁTICA 07 DECODIFICADOR COMERCIAL CI 74138 DECODIFICADOR BCD PARA DISPLAY DE 7 SEGMENTOS Objetivos: Apresentar o funcionamento do decodificador comercial CI 74138. Apresentar o funcionamento de um display de 7 segmentos, assim como a sua utilização por meio de decodificadores BCD. Desenvolver um circuito lógico combinacional de um decodificador BCD-7S. 1. INTRODUÇÃO TEÓRICA 1.1. DECODIFICADOR COMERCIAL - 74138 O principal decodificador comercial é o circuito integrado da família TTL conhecido pelo código de identificação como 74138. A Tabela 7.1 apresenta o descritivo funcional deste circuito. Tabele 7.1. Tabela-verdade do decodificador 74138. Este é um decodificador 3x8 linhas, que pode ser cascateado para produzir decodificadores de maior capacidade, para isso utilizam-se as entradas de habilitação do 74138.

Transcript of AulaPratica07Decodificadores

Page 1: AulaPratica07Decodificadores

CENTRO UNIVERSITÁRIO UNA INSTITUTO POLITÉCNICO

Laboratório de Sistemas Digitais

Professores: Breno Arêdes e Hugo Michel

AULA PRÁTICA 07

DECODIFICADOR COMERCIAL CI 74138 DECODIFICADOR BCD PARA DISPLAY DE 7 SEGMENTOS

Objetivos:

Apresentar o funcionamento do decodificador comercial CI 74138.

Apresentar o funcionamento de um display de 7 segmentos, assim como a sua

utilização por meio de decodificadores BCD.

Desenvolver um circuito lógico combinacional de um decodificador BCD-7S.

1. INTRODUÇÃO TEÓRICA

1.1. DECODIFICADOR COMERCIAL - 74138

O principal decodificador comercial é o circuito integrado da família TTL

conhecido pelo código de identificação como 74138. A Tabela 7.1 apresenta o

descritivo funcional deste circuito.

Tabele 7.1. Tabela-verdade do decodificador 74138.

Este é um decodificador 3x8 linhas, que pode ser cascateado para produzir

decodificadores de maior capacidade, para isso utilizam-se as entradas de habilitação

do 74138.

Page 2: AulaPratica07Decodificadores

CENTRO UNIVERSITÁRIO UNA INSTITUTO POLITÉCNICO

Laboratório de Sistemas Digitais

Professores: Breno Arêdes e Hugo Michel

Como exemplo tem-se dois circuitos integrados 74138 interligados para

construir um decodificador 4x16.

Figura 7.1. Expansão de decodificadores utilizando o CI 74138.

Note que quando E4 = 0, o primeiro 74138 é habilitado e quando E4 = 1, o

segundo 74138 é habilitado. Note também que, aumentando a capacidade do

decodificador para 16 saídas, são necessárias 4 entradas para endereçá-las

separadamente.

Se, por exemplo, E4 E3 E2 E1 = 1000, o primeiro circuito integrado estará

desabilitado e, portanto todas as suas saídas estarão em nível lógico 1. O segundo

circuito integrado estará habilitado e endereçará a saída Y0, que então estará em

nível lógico zero. Portanto, no conjunto, a saída endereçada será a saída S08.

Page 3: AulaPratica07Decodificadores

CENTRO UNIVERSITÁRIO UNA INSTITUTO POLITÉCNICO

Laboratório de Sistemas Digitais

Professores: Breno Arêdes e Hugo Michel

1.2. DISPLAY DE 7 SEGMENTOS

Os displays de 7 segmentos se tornaram viáveis com o surgimento e a

disponibilidade crescente dos LED’s (Light-Emitting Diode) no mercado. O LED é um

semicondutor similar o diodo, diferenciado-se no valor da queda de tensão de sua

barreira de depleção (cerca de + ou – 1,6V) e no fato de que a sua junção, quando

polarizada, emite uma luz monocromática. A Figura 7.2 apresenta o diagrama

eletrônico atualmente utilizado para representar o LED:

Figura 7.2. Diagrama eletrônico de um LED.

Mais informações sobre o funcionamento e utilização dos LED’s podem ser

encontradas em (How Stuffs Works, 2008). Um display de 7 segmentos nada mais é

do que um arranjo de LED’s como mostrado na Figura 7.3.

Figura 7.3. Display de 7 segmentos.

Existem dois tipos de display de 7 segmentos no que se refere à forma de

ligação destes. Tem-se o Catodo comum e o Anodo comum. A Figura 7.4 mostra os

dois tipos:

Catodo Anodo

a

b

c

d

e

f g

Page 4: AulaPratica07Decodificadores

CENTRO UNIVERSITÁRIO UNA INSTITUTO POLITÉCNICO

Laboratório de Sistemas Digitais

Professores: Breno Arêdes e Hugo Michel

a b c d e f g a b c d e f g

VCC

(a) (b)

Figura 7.4. (a) Display de 7 segmentos catodo comum (b) Display de 7

segmentos anodo comum.

Pela Figura 8.4, percebe-se que as duas formas de ligação dos displays implicam

na forma como os LEDs deverão ser acesos. No caso do tipo catodo comum, tem-se

que para o acendimento dos LEDs os terminais a-g deverão estar em nível lógico alto.

Já no caso catodo comum, os teminais a-g deverão estar em nível lógico baixo.

1.3. DECODIFICADOR BCD

Ao longo da história dos sistemas digitais e, conseqüentemente, da computação

digital, vários padrões de codificação foram desenvolvidos para caracterizar uma

“palavra” binária, e.g., uma letra possui 8 bits, i.e., um caractere de determinado

idioma (e.g., o português). Atualmente, o padrão mais utilizado é o ASCII (American

Standard Code for Information Interchange) em sua versão expandida. Trata-se de

um padrão de codificação de 8 bits, i.e., com até 256 caracteres diferentes.

De forma mais simples, o código BCD, determina até 16 caracteres (4 bits)

diferentes, sendo os dez primeiros os números de 0 a 9, os seis caracteres restantes

ficam a mercê do projetista. É usual termos tais caracteres representando as letras A,

B, C, D, E e F, caracterizando a base numérica hexadecimal.

Page 5: AulaPratica07Decodificadores

CENTRO UNIVERSITÁRIO UNA INSTITUTO POLITÉCNICO

Laboratório de Sistemas Digitais

Professores: Breno Arêdes e Hugo Michel

2. MATERIAIS E EQUIPAMENTOS

- Computador com o Software EWB instalado.

- Folhas de especificações de CI’s;

- Circuitos Integrados;

- 01 Maleta Minipa Eletrônica Digital e Analógica;

- Protoboard, fios e cabos;

3. PROCEDIMENTOS PRÁTICOS

PP1. Utilizar o kit Minipa para verificar o funcionamento do CI 74138. Explicar seu

funcionamento utilizando a tabela verdade.

PP2. Construir um decodificador de 4 bits do código BCD para o código 7 segmentos.

A figura a seguir apresenta os números de 0 a 9 em um display de 7 segmentos.

Realizar o desenvolvimento do projeto utilizando os procedimentos a seguir:

a) Desenvolver a Tabela Verdade (TV).

b) Desenvolver os Mapas K para as saída a, b, c, d, e, f, g para determinar as

expressões simplificadas.

c) Implementar o circuito lógico no EWB a partir das expressões obtidas.

Page 6: AulaPratica07Decodificadores

CENTRO UNIVERSITÁRIO UNA INSTITUTO POLITÉCNICO

Laboratório de Sistemas Digitais

Professores: Breno Arêdes e Hugo Michel

4. CONCLUSÕES E DISCUSSÕES

Comente pelo menos um dos objetivos propostos para esta prática.

5. SUGESTÕES

Há alguma sugestão para melhoria desta esta prática?

6. REFERÊNCIAS

TOCCI, R. J.; WIDMER, N. S. Sistemas Digitais: Princípios e Aplicações. 10°.

Edição. Editora Pearson, São Paulo, SP, 2000.

GARCIA, P. A.; MARTINI, J. S. C. Eletrônica Digital: Teoria e Laboratório. 1ª.

Edição. Editora Érica, São Paulo, SP, 2006.

BRAGA, A. P.; PARMA, G. G. Notas de Aulas Práticas do Curso de Laboratório de

Sistemas Digitais, Escola de Engenharia, UFMG. 2006.

How Stuffs Works (2008): website http://electronics.howstuffworks.com/led1.htm,

acessado em outubro de 2008.

ASCII Table (2008): website http://www.asciitable.com/, acessado em outubro de

2008.